The cheapest way to get from Champaign to Des Plaines is to drive which costs $27 - $40 and takes 2h 37m.
The fastest way to get from Champaign to Des Plaines is to fly which takes 1h 57m and costs $45 - $300.
No, there is no direct bus from Champaign to Des Plaines station. However, there are services departing from Illinois Terminal and arriving at Des Plaines Metra Station via Northwest Transportation Center.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 47m.
No, there is no direct train from Champaign to Des Plaines. However, there are services departing from Champaign-Urbana and arriving at Des Plaines via Chicago OTC.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 46m.
The distance between Champaign and Des Plaines is 145 miles. The road distance is 149.7 miles.
The best way to get from Champaign to Des Plaines without a car is to train which takes 3h 46m and costs $45 - $95.
It takes approximately 1h 57m to get from Champaign to Des Plaines, including transfers.
Champaign to Des Plaines bus services, operated by Jefferson Lines, depart from Illinois Terminal station.
Champaign to Des Plaines train services, operated by Amtrak, depart from Champaign-Urbana station.
The best way to get from Champaign to Des Plaines is to fly which takes 1h 57m and costs $45 - $300. Alternatively, you can train, which costs $45 - $95 and takes 3h 46m, you could also bus via Northwest Transportation Center, which costs $45 - $65 and takes 4h 47m.
